From owner-freebsd-current@FreeBSD.ORG Mon Mar 20 14:22:45 2006 Return-Path: X-Original-To: current@freebsd.org Delivered-To: freebsd-current@FreeBSD.ORG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id D3BD316A400 for ; Mon, 20 Mar 2006 14:22:45 +0000 (UTC) (envelope-from xdivac02@stud.fit.vutbr.cz) Received: from eva.fit.vutbr.cz (eva.fit.vutbr.cz [147.229.10.14]) by mx1.FreeBSD.org (Postfix) with ESMTP id D3CB343D46 for ; Mon, 20 Mar 2006 14:22:43 +0000 (GMT) (envelope-from xdivac02@stud.fit.vutbr.cz) Received: from eva.fit.vutbr.cz (localhost [127.0.0.1]) by eva.fit.vutbr.cz (envelope-from xdivac02@eva.fit.vutbr.cz) (8.13.4/8.13.3) with ESMTP id k2KEMc35058473 (version=TLSv1/SSLv3 cipher=EDH-RSA-DES-CBC3-SHA bits=168 verify=NO); Mon, 20 Mar 2006 15:22:38 +0100 (CET) Received: (from xdivac02@localhost) by eva.fit.vutbr.cz (8.13.4/8.13.3/Submit) id k2KEMcvQ058472; Mon, 20 Mar 2006 15:22:38 +0100 (CET) Date: Mon, 20 Mar 2006 15:22:38 +0100 From: Divacky Roman To: Alexander Leidinger Message-ID: <20060320142238.GA58114@stud.fit.vutbr.cz> References: <200603191110.k2JBAYxC085982@repoman.freebsd.org> <20060319113039.GD89287@ip.net.ua> <20060319172522.6d93c008@Magellan.Leidinger.net> <20060320082756.GA21146@stud.fit.vutbr.cz> <20060320094304.r0dpk00b48gkws8k@netchild.homeip.net>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20060320094304.r0dpk00b48gkws8k@netchild.homeip.net> User-Agent: Mutt/1.4.2i X-Scanned-By: MIMEDefang 2.49 on 147.229.10.14 Cc: current@freebsd.org Subject: Re: linuxolator broken on alpha/amd64 (was: Re: cvs commit: src/sys/amd64/linux32 linux32_sysvec.c syscalls.master src/sys/compat/linux linux_file.c linux_getcwd.c linux_ioctl.c linux_ipc.c linux_mib.c linux_misc.c linux_signal.c linux_socket.c linux_stats.c linux_sysctl.c linux_uid16.c) X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 20 Mar 2006 14:22:45 -0000 On Mon, Mar 20, 2006 at 09:43:04AM +0100, Alexander Leidinger wrote: > Divacky Roman wrote: > > >>Does anyone know the linux syscall numbers on alpha/amd64 for lstat? > >>They need to be added to the corresponding syscalls.master. > > > >in my patch I had lstat as syscall 84, you changed that to stat. I > >had reports > >it worked on amd64.. why did you change it? > > I don't know how it happened, but somehow my tree got messed up. I did not > use an editor to change anything before my first commit. It's strange. > > Can you please "cvs update" the files, resolve the conflicts (should be > "just > removing some strange lines and keeping the right lines") and send me the > patch per email to Alexander@Leidinger.net? unfortunately I've already done this using the version you commited as the correct one :( but the fix should be just sed -e 's/linux_stat/linux_lstat' if I looked at it correctly but I dont have much time today (exam at school) so pls recheck this > If you don't have time to do it until the evening (let's say in the next 8 > hours), I will try to fix "my mess" myself when I'm back home. pls do so...